Ormeño Ruiz Earns Second Team All-Pac-12

May 12, 2017 | Tennis

BOULDER – University of Colorado tennis player Nuria Ormeño Ruiz was named to the All-Pac-12 second-team here Friday in the conference's postseason awards voted by the coaches. It is the second conference award she has earned in her career as she was named to the honorable mention team last year.
 
A Barcelona, Spain native, Ormeño Ruiz led CU in her final season. Ormeño Ruiz recorded a 19-14 singles record including 10-10 in the No. 1 singles spot.  She also had a team high 19 wins. Ormeño Ruiz had many senior year highlights including powering past No. 51 ranked Caroline Doyle of Stanford in April. She defeated Doyle 6-0, 6-4.
 
For her career, she posted an 80-50 career singles record, including 18-20 at the No. 1 singles position. She also went 58-52 in doubles play. She defeated a total of eight nationally ranked opponents during her career including six in singles play.
 
Nuria Ormeño Ruiz Career Highlights
• 19-14 overall and 10-10 at No. 1
• Moved into a tie for ninth place in CU history for wins at No. 1 singles with her 15th career
victory at that position on Feb. 15 at Air Force
• Won the CU Invitational singles championship with a 3-0 record and was also 3-0 in
doubles play.
• Went 3-0 in qualifying at the Riviera/ITA All-American Championships against three
nationally-ranked opponents before falling in the Round of 32 of the Main Draw to North
Carolina's Sara Daavettila, the top-ranked freshman in the nation.
• Upset No. 74 Gabriela Porubin (Wichita State), No. 33 Andie Daniell (Alabama) and No. 59
Gabriela Knutson (Syracuse) in the Qualifying Draw at the All-American Championships.
• Finished the fall with a team-best 8-3 singles record and 5-1 doubles record, reaching the
round of 16 at the ITA Mountain Regional in singles and the quarterfinals in doubles.
• Paired with Louise Ronaldson to upset 43rd-ranked Blaga Delic/Sheila Morales from
Nevada 8-3 in the round of 16 of the ITA regional.
• Went 3-1 with Jeannez Daniel at the IU Winter Invitational in doubles.
• Became first-ever CU player to qualify for and compete at National Indoor Championships
after winning the ITA Mountain Region singles championship in 2015.
• Named CU Female Athlete of the Week on Oct. 20, 2015 after her regional championship.
• Led the team in singles wins (23), No. 1 singles wins (7), tournament wins (11), Pac-12
wins (4) and dual-match wins (12) in 2015-16.
• Her 23 singles wins last season ranked 28th in CU single-season history.
• Earned a 6-1, 1-6, 6-3 win over 27th-ranked Lauren Marker in CU's 4-3 win over Arizona
on March 13, 2016, her first win over a ranked opponent last season.
• Earned a 6-4 doubles win over the 40th-ranked doubles pair from Northern Colorado on
Feb. 12, 2016.
• Ranks 18th in CU history in singles wins (69), 13th in singles winning percentage (.639)
and 22nd in combined singles and doubles wins (113).
• Led the team with two match-clinching singles wins and four doubles-clinching wins in
2015-16.
